CLERK'S NOTICE: Pursuant to Local Rule 73.1(b), a United States Magistrate Judge of this court is available to conduct all proceedings in this civil action. If all parties consent to have the currently assigned United States Magistrate Judge conduct all proceedings in this case, including trial, the entry of final judgment, and all post-trial proceedings, all parties must sign their names on the attached Consent To form. This consent form is eligible for filing only if executed by all parties. The parties can also express their consent to jurisdiction by a magistrate judge in any joint filing, including the Joint Initial Status Report or proposed Case Management Order. (qrtr,)

MINUTE entry before the Honorable Sara L. Ellis: The Court grants Plaintiff's motion for leave to file under seal 13 and for leave to file excess pages 14. The Court denies Plaintiff's motion for temporary restraining order 8 without prejudice. Plaintiff filed this case against 54 defendants for design patent infringement. Under Rule 20, a plaintiff may join multiple defendants in a single action if: (1) the claims against them are asserted with respect to or arising out of the same transaction, occurrence, or series of transactions or occurrences, and (2) a question of law or fact common to all defendants exists. Fed. R. Civ. P. 20(a)(2)(A)(B). In reviewing the filings in this case, it does not appear that joinder is proper as to all Defendants. As the Court stated in Roadget Business Pte. Ltd. v. The Individuals, Corporations, Limited Liability Cos., Partnerships, and Unincorporated Associations Identified on Schedule A Hereto, alleging that multiple defendants have infringed on the same copyright, trademark, or patent in the same way, without more, does not create the substantial evidentiary overlap required to find joinder proper. No. 23 C 17036, 2024 WL 1858592, at *67 (N.D. Ill. Apr. 29, 2024). The Court directs Plaintiff to file an amended complaint by 5/23/2025, as well as a statement on joinder explaining how the remaining Defendants comply with the Court's order in Roadget. The Court also cautions Plaintiff that, in order to support preliminary injunctive relief, it must show that the named defendants' alleged infringement remains active and ongoing. The Court thus orders Plaintiff to ensure that it only seeks preliminary injunctive relief from defendants whose alleged infringement remains active and ongoing.
